
A magnitude 5.1 earthquake has been reported this morning on a Saturday in the province of Aurora. It struck 15 kilometers southwest of San Luis, Aurora at 10:10 a.m.
It has a depth of 7 kilometers and is tectonic in origin according to the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ology (PHIVOLCS).
The following instrumental intensities have been recorded:
Intensity VI – Baler, Aurora; Intensity IV – Palayan City; Dingalan, Aurora; Intensity II – Quezon City; Intensity IV – Palayan City
The quake was also felt in other parts of Region III (Central Luzon), the National Capital Region (NCR), the Cordillera Administrative Region (CAR), Region I (Ilocos Region) and Region IV-A (Calabarzon).
No damages yet reported but aftershocks are expected.
